MasterChef Junior, the beloved culinary competition series that invites talented kids between the ages of 8 and 13 to showcase their skills, has been warming hearts and inspiring viewers since its premiere. As a spin-off of the MasterChef series, it has seen numerous young chefs pass through its kitchen, leaving with new skills, experiences, and occasionally life-changing opportunities. But what happens to these culinary prodigies after the cameras stop rolling and the aprons come off? This article delves into the lives of some of the most memorable contestants from MasterChef Junior, exploring their journeys and net worth as of 2024.

Alexander Weiss
Alexander, the first winner of MasterChef Junior, has staged in several high-end restaurants and is working towards opening his own establishment. His net worth is estimated to be around $120,000, adjusting for inflation.
Logan Guleff
Logan, the second season winner, has published his own cookbook and has extensive media exposure. His net worth, adjusted for inflation, is estimated at $180,000.
Dara Yu
Dara, runner-up of the first season, continues to offer cooking classes and workshops. Her net worth for 2024 stands at approximately $60,000.
